Comprehending the Megaways Stake Grid and Core Wager
Before reviewing limits, we must comprehend what we are betting on. The Megaways engine indicates each spin can show a variable number of symbols per reel, generating up to 117,649 ways to win. Your bet covers all available ways produced on that spin. The base stake is computed by multiplying your picked coin value by a set number of coins per spin, which is 20 in this game. Your total bet per spin is: Coin Value x 20. This setup is consistent, but volatility lies in the constantly shifting win ways. You pay a flat fee for access to a ever-evolving playing field where payout potential changes with every spin.

The visible grid expands and contracts, but this does not alter your spin’s cost. If the reels show 117,649 ways or a smaller number, your stake stays the same, established exclusively by the coin value multiplier. This is critical for Canadian players to understand. You are not staking “per way” but purchasing a ticket for the whole Megaways draw on that spin. This renders budget management foreseeable, as your outlay per spin is fixed. Your focus moves to picking a coin value that permits a viable session while keeping room to enable optional features like the Super Bet.
Comprehensive Breakdown of Bet Amounts and Total Bet Range
Let’s look at the numbers offered at Canadian online casinos. Extra Chilli Megaways offers a broad spectrum of coin values, serving casual players and high rollers. The specific minimum and maximum can vary slightly by operator, but the standard range is thorough. The lowest coin value usually is set at $0.01, while the highest can reach $0.50 or even $1.00. Using our formula (Coin Value x 20), we calculate the actual cash stake per spin.
- Lowest Stake Example: A $0.01 coin value provides a total bet of $0.01 x 20 = $0.20 per spin. This ultra-low entry is great for extended practice or casual play.
- Low to Mid-Range Bets: A $0.10 coin value produces a $2.00 per spin bet. This is a typical stake for players wanting balance between engagement and bankroll longevity.
- Large Wager Example: At a maximum typical coin value of $0.50, the total bet becomes $0.50 x 20 = $10.00 per spin. Some casinos offer a $1.00 coin, producing a $20 per spin wager for high-rollers.
This range, from twenty cents to twenty dollars per spin, provides immense flexibility. It allows you to adjust risk and potential reward in straight proportion to your comfort. We recommend starting at the lower end to build a feel for the game’s high volatility. The swings can be significant, and a conservative approach lets you experience bonus features without swiftly depleting your balance. Once comfortable, you can modify your coin value accordingly.
The Role of the Super Bet Feature within Your Wager
On top of the base stake, Extra Chilli Megaways features an optional Super Bet. This is a key component of betting strategy, impacting game mechanics. Triggering it requires an additional 25% on top of your base stake. If your base bet is $4.00 (e.g., coin value $0.20), Super Bet adds $1.00, making your total investment $5.00 per spin. This is not minor, and grasping what it provides is crucial for an informed decision.
The Super Bet alters the game’s probability in two key ways. First, it assures that any trigger of the Free Spins bonus begins with the maximum initial multiplier of 5x. Without it, free spins can commence at a lower multiplier (1x, 2x, 3x, or 5x), cutting potential peak wins. Second, it enhances the frequency of the Chili Peppers symbol. This symbol is critical to the multiplier system, as accumulating them during the “Coin Collection” feature or free spins boosts your win multiplier. Consequently, the Super Bet directly enhances the probability of reaching the high-multiplier states that shape the game’s top win potential.

The influence of Bet Size on Winning Potential and RTP
A popular fallacy is that betting higher improves your probability of winning. In Extra Chilli Megaways, as in all legitimate slots, the Random Number Generator determines outcomes independently of stake size. A $0.20 spin has the equal likelihood of activating the bonus or a 1000x win as a $10.00 spin. The variation is only monetary: the monetary value of that 1000x win is $200 versus $10,000. Your stake size multiplies the result, not the inherent odds. The Super Bet is the special case, as it changes the game’s mechanics by increasing symbol frequency and locking the free spins multiplier.

The published RTP experiences a small rise when Super Bet is enabled because it boosts the mean return of bonus games. However, this is a extended statistical norm. For you, the individual player in a single session, this theoretical change is meaningless. What is important is the instant financial consequence: you pay 25% extra per spin for a chance at a qualitatively better bonus. The “value” of that compromise is personal, hinging completely on your budget and risk appetite. A player with a restricted bankroll may find the base game offers better entertainment per dollar, while a player aiming for maximum wins will view Super Bet as essential.
